One of the important raw materials in beer is hops, which gives beer special bitterness The ingredients in hops are light sensitive and will decompose under the action of ultraviolet rays in the sun, resulting in unpleasant sunlight odor Colored glass bottles can reduce this reaction to a certain extent Adding tin foil at the bottleneck can reduce the transmission of ultraviolet light, reduce the odor of sunlight, and prevent and reduce corrosion. Some brands of beer, such as Budweiser's tin foil logo, also has anti-counterfeiting function, and has a red Budweiser logo with temperature sensitive discoloration, With the rapid development of beer packaging industry, most breweries are using aluminum foil for beer bottle mouth label (hereinafter referred to as beer label), and the current product is 80112o, 0.0115mm foil. In the following, the technological process, mechanical properties, pinholes and user's technical requirements of producing aluminum foil for beer standard with cast rolling billets are reviewed, and the development trend of aluminum foil for beer standard is predicted
1. Main technical indicators of aluminum foil for beer standard
1.1 chemical composition of aluminum foil for beer standard
in China, the chemical composition of aluminum foil for beer standard, whether produced from hot rolled billets or cast rolled billets, is 8011 alloy, and the main composition of the alloy is shown in Table 1. However, in production, the actual control composition range of different manufacturers is different. For example, North China Aluminum Company uses alloys with low composition control range to produce aluminum foil for beer standard. The control range of its chemical composition mainly considers that the technical indicators such as tensile strength, elongation and aluminum foil needle porosity of the product should meet the requirements of users
1.2 mechanical properties
at present, the thickness of aluminum foil for beer standard is 0.0115mm. Generally, strip tensile specimens can only be used for mechanical property inspection, that is, tensile specimens with 15mm width, 170mm length and 100mm gauge distance of parallel parts. According to the user's use effect, the tensile strength of 80112o, 0.0115mm aluminum foil for beer standard is generally between 80 ~ 90n/mm2, and the elongation is 2% - 2.5%. In addition, different users have additional requirements, such as burst strength. These technical indicators are generally inspected by the wine label printing factory, and the aluminum foil supplier is not tested separately through process assurance
1.3 requirements for pinhole and surface quality of aluminum foil
thinner beer label aluminum foil can be used for sealing after color coating, so the requirements for its surface quality are high, and the surface of aluminum foil is not allowed to have oil spots, obvious marks and other defects. After the beer label is printed, holes should be evenly punched on the surface of the aluminum foil, which can be said to be the unique process requirements of the beer label during microcomputer operation. Therefore, the requirements for the pinhole of the aluminum foil are very strict, and pinhole defects on the aluminum foil are almost not allowed. If there are many original pinholes in the aluminum foil and the pinholes on the finished beer label itself, the surface of the aluminum foil will become a sieve, and other properties of the aluminum foil will also deteriorate, which will seriously affect the labeling speed of the brewery. However, at present, domestic beer labels supplied with cast rolled billets can achieve small aluminum foil pinholes, which can basically meet the user's requirements in this regard
2. Key points of production process control of beer standard aluminum foil
the following only comments on the key points of process control of beer standard aluminum foil production from cast rolling blank. The process flow is: cast rolling smelting composition adjustment, static furnace refining, degassing, adding grain refiner, filtering, cast rolling, cold rolling, heat treatment in the middle thickness, aluminum foil rolling, double combination rolling, finished products cutting, finished products heat treatment, inspection and packaging
2.1 key points of process control in the casting and rolling process
in the casting and rolling production process, the quality control of aluminum melt is relatively strict. In addition to normal adjustment of composition and thorough slag removal, the melt poured into the holding furnace (static furnace) should be refined. The refining time depends on the weight of furnace charge, which should generally be more than 15min. The refining medium is N2 or n2+ccl4; Before casting and rolling, refining shall be carried out to minimize the hydrogen content of aluminum melt entering the casting and rolling area
in order to control the grain size of cast rolled slabs, grain refiners should be added before the melt enters the filter box. Al2ti2b wire with a diameter of 9.5 ~ 10mm is commonly used, and the adding speed is slightly different according to the slab width and casting and rolling speed. For example, when producing 7.5mm 1200mm cast rolled slabs at a casting and rolling speed of 1.0m/min, the adding speed of al2ti2b wire is generally 200 ~ 250mm/min
2.2 key points of process control of cold rolling and foil rolling
2.2.1 cold rolling and foil rolling
aluminum foil for beer standard has high requirements for shape and surface quality. It is necessary to select a newly ground work roll for aluminum foil rolling of finished product passes. The work roll and guide roll should be in good condition. Set or select appropriate shape curve in each pass to ensure the flatness of aluminum foil
2.2.2 heat treatment of intermediate thickness and finished product thickness
in China, when producing beer standard aluminum foil with cast rolled blank, it is generally annealed in the middle pass of cold rolling. Because the annealing temperature is high (generally above 500 ℃), it is called homogenization annealing. Different manufacturers choose to conduct intermediate annealing in different thicknesses, such as 2.0mm or 0.8mm thick. Homogenization annealing can not only improve the calendering performance of billets, but also improve the elongation of aluminum foil. The factors to be considered when annealing the finished aluminum foil are to eliminate the rolling oil on the surface of the aluminum foil and ensure the mechanical properties of the finished product. Generally, low temperature and long-time insulation are used for oil removal, such as (180 ~ 230) ℃ (20 ~ 30) h, and the oil removal effect can reach the class a water brushing performance specified in gb3198 standard; Considering that the mechanical properties should meet the requirements of technical standards, it is generally annealed at a temperature above 300 ℃ for 20 ~ 30h

finally, the development trend of aluminum foil for beer label is described. Beer label is developing towards the trend of thinning, alloying and high performance. The goal of domestic aluminum foil manufacturers to conduct process research is also roughly in this direction
the thinning trend of aluminum foil for beer standard. At present, the general thickness of aluminum foil for beer standard is 0.0115mm, and some domestic and foreign-funded enterprises have proposed to reduce its thickness
